On Tue, 2010-12-21 at 17:09 -0800, Venkatesh Pallipadi wrote:
> softirq time in ksoftirqd context is not accounted in ns granularity
> per cpu softirq stats, as we want that to be a part of ksoftirqd
> exec_runtime.
> 
> Accounting them as softirq on /proc/stat separately.
> 
> Tested-by: Shaun Ruffell <sruffell@digium.com>
> Signed-off-by: Venkatesh Pallipadi <venki@google.com>
> ---
>  kernel/sched.c |    8 ++++++++
>  1 files changed, 8 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/kernel/sched.c b/kernel/sched.c
> index 193b1d0..4ff6d1a 100644
> --- a/kernel/sched.c
> +++ b/kernel/sched.c
> @@ -3819,6 +3819,14 @@ static void irqtime_account_process_tick(struct task_struct *p, int user_tick,
>  		cpustat->irq = cputime64_add(cpustat->irq, tmp);
>  	} else if (irqtime_account_si_update()) {
>  		cpustat->softirq = cputime64_add(cpustat->softirq, tmp);
> +	} else if (this_cpu_ksoftirqd() == p) {
> +		/*
> +		 * ksoftirqd time do not get accounted in cpu_softirq_time.
> +		 * So, we have to handle it separately here.
> +		 * Also, p->stime needs to be updated for ksoftirqd.
> +		 */
> +		__account_system_time(p, cputime_one_jiffy, one_jiffy_scaled,
> +					&cpustat->softirq);
>  	} else if (user_tick) {
>  		account_user_time(p, cputime_one_jiffy, one_jiffy_scaled);
>  	} else if (p == rq->idle) {

So you add the ksoftirqd runtime as softirq time in the /proc/stat
output?

That seems dubious...
